The surname 'Hradsky' is of Czech and Slovak origin, derived from the word 'hrad,' which means 'castle' or 'fortress' in the Czech and Slovak languages. The suffix '-sky' is a common suffix in Slavic surnames, denoting 'of' or 'from.' Therefore, 'Hradsky' can be interpreted as 'of the castle' or 'from the fortress.' This suggests that the original bearers of the surname 'Hradsky' may have been associated with a castle or fortress in some way, either as residents, owners, or defenders.
Like many surnames, 'Hradsky' has undergone various spellings and adaptations over time and across different regions. Some common variations of the surname include 'Hradski,' 'Hradský,' 'Hradska,' and 'Hradske.' These variations may reflect regional dialects, phonetic changes, or transcription errors. Despite these variations, the core meaning and origin of the surname remain consistent.
